In theory, would his athleticism be "elite" if he was running a different O/D? 60 team rating for ATH seems pretty solid for D2.
7/15/2018 6:54 PM
Elite and pretty solid are very different. It would be a competitive number in other sets, but by no means elite. I have a team ath of 63 with one team and it's ranked 18th in D2 and i'm a 2nd round type of team there. (Flex zone)

I have a team ath of 64 and it ranks 9th. (Triangle Man) That team is worthy of a deep run. But it all depends on what else you have too.

But 60 ATH for a team average isn't elite anywhere, in my opinion. Check your worlds you play in now. You just joined RMAC in Phelan, right? (Puke! Haha) Click the team ratings of D2 ATH in that world. I bet 60 doesn't even show up on the top 25 list. Or if it does it's close to the bottom

(when I say rank, i'm just talking about on the team ratings page. Not the rank of a team's performance)

A 60 ath team can be elite in D2, even with FB/press; but it won’t be because of elite athleticism. It’s serviceable, and can be very competitive (as terps team shows). It wouldn’t have been surprising if FGC made the final 4, or farther.

I’d be plenty confident with a high skills triangle (or flex) / zone team at 60 athleticism in D2. Lots of ways to build winning teams.
